Abstract
Abstract
The abstract describing the content of the publication or report
Abstract:
Wessex Archaeology was commissioned by URS on behalf of Muse Development Limited, to undertake archaeological evaluation trenching at College Road, Doncaster, South Yorkshire, NGR 457667 4029944. Previous archaeological fieldwork at Waterdale NPV, 200m to the west of the Site, revealed a Romano-British cemetery. Following geotechnical investigations within the Site an area to the northwest of the former Technical College was targeted for archaeological evaluation. Two evaluation trenches were excavated and 19th century garden features and an undated ditch and posthole were revealed. A buried ploughsoil contained a sherd of Romano-British pottery but no dating evidence was recovered from the archaeological features. The Site lay within the location of Chequer Lane Gardens, which is shown on OS maps until the early 20th century. The garden features are most likely associated with planting within those gardens.
